IMPORTANT: Do not perform this procedure for erratic solution
pump rate or pressure if the A and B numbers are within range. If
A and B numbers are within range, see entries for erratic rate or
pressure in the Troubleshooting Section.
Only calibrate the solution pump when the A and B values do
not lie within their ranges or when one of the following has been
replaced:
-
Turn off the solution pump switch.

Select the Menu button.
-
Select the Sprayer Application button.
-
Select the Calibration Menu softkey
(A).
-
Select the Spray Calibration tab (B).
-
Select the Solution Pump Calibration button (C). Solution Pump Calibration page is displayed.
IMPORTANT: To avoid the solution pump from running dry, fill
the solution tank with enough water or solution and warm up the hydraulic
oil before calibrating the solution pump.
-
Follow all instructions shown on the first Solution Pump Calibration page.

When finished, select the Enter button
(A).
-
Wait for the calibration to be completed.
NOTE: The solution pump calibration takes approximately 1—2
min. The solution pump is turned off when the auto calibration is
done.
-
Solution pump calibration is complete message is displayed. Select the Enter button (A).
